James Oglethorpe established Georgia as a US colony in 1732.  Initially, it was intended to be a refuge for indebted prisoners from London.  But, Georgia later served as a buffer territory to protect South Carolina and other southern colonies with able-bodied farmers.  They protected the southern colonies from Spanish invasion through Florida.
